摘要

创新创业能力是新工科对高等教育人才培养的首要要求,新工科背景下的创新创业教育成为高校教育改革的重要内容.在培养新工科所需的具备创新创业能力专业人才的过程中,环保意识的教育和培养,不仅关系人才培养的专业素养,更关系未来产业和行业的可持续发展.文中结合本校机械工程专业特色,聚焦环境保护、环境治理等社会热点问题,在指导学生创新设计、创业训练活动中,贯彻可持续发展观和环保理念,使环保意识教育在创新创业活动中得以渗透和实践,使学生在实践过程中建立环保意识的职业素养.

Abstract

The abilities of innovation and entrepreneurship are essential to cultivate the talents of higher education in terms of new engineering;the innovation and entrepreneurship education in the context of new engineering becomes an important compo-nent of the educational reform in universities.In order to cultivate the new-engineering talents with such abilities of innovation and entrepreneurship,it is of great significance to raise the environment-protection awareness,which is not only helpful to raise the students'professional capacity,but also contributes to the sustainable development of the future industries.In this article,ac-cording to the characteristics of the mechanical engineering specialty in our university,efforts are made to explore the heated so-cial issues,such as environment protection and governance;the concepts of sustainable development and environment protection are implemented to guide the students in the innovative design and entrepreneurship training activities.Therefore,the educational system of the environment-protection awareness is carried out in the innovation and entrepreneurship activities,where the students are equipped with the environment-protection awareness on their career path.
